Vader was found in 2019 as a stray in our neighborhood. With how friendly and approachable he was, it was unclear whether he had a home prior to us adopting him. Upon taking him to the vet, we learned he was around one, not chipped/fixed, so we brought him into the family.
As of today, Vader is about seven years old with a spunky yet sweet personality. Currently, he lives with three other cats - two girls and one boy - though we know he would be happiest as the only cat as he shows some territorial anxiety towards them. However, he is wonderful with dogs, children and people!
Vader loves many things, such as watching birds, having a tall cat tree to climb and sleep in and making biscuits on blankets. He is a snuggly boy who loves to talk, and is an avid player! He also loves to sit on the screened-in porch and look for squirrels. If you would like to learn more about our little void boy, please reach out! He is a very special guy, and would love to meet you!
